- The distance between Pelly Bay, Nt, Canada and Sesheke, Zambia is approximately 12,782 km or 7,943 mi.
- To reach Pelly Bay, Nt in this distance one would set out from Sesheke bearing 338.3°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Pelly Bay, Nt bearing 253.9° or WSW .
- Pelly Bay, Nt has a tundra climate (ET) whereas Sesheke has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a).
- Pelly Bay, Nt is in or near the polar desert biome whereas Sesheke is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The average temperature is 36.6 °C (65.9°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 28.8 °C (51.8°F) more in Pelly Bay, Nt.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 524.4 mm (20.6 in) less which is equivalent to 524.4 l/m² (12.87 US gal/ft²) or 5,244,000 l/ha (560,618 US gal/ac) less. About 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 48° lower in Pelly Bay, Nt than in Sesheke.
